How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Carver Park?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Carver Park Studio Apartments | $943 | $875 | $1,100 |
| Carver Park 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,259 | $532 | $2,450 |
| Carver Park 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,549 | $775 | $3,695 |
| Carver Park 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,223 | $1,100 | $3,033 |
| Carver Park 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,895 | $2,895 | $2,895 |
